Description
Book Synopsis: Eichblatt has distilled his 25 years of practical experience and wisdom into this much-needed guidebook to test and evaluation of tactical missiles. With this book in hand, the reader can determine whether the weapon meets its requirements, how well it functions operationally, and whether or not it should continue into production. This readable text is amply supplemented by hundreds of tables and diagrams. Also included are useful appendices on proportional navigation, Laplace transforms, Doppler, and radome refraction.
